HGV Class 2 Hiab

Lawsons is proud to be the UK’s largest independent supplier of fencing, timber and building materials. Established in 1921, with over 35 branches and 700+ colleagues across London and the South East, we continue to thrive by building lasting relationships with customers and cultivating a strong, supportive team culture. We are recruiting for an experienced HGV Class 2 Hiab driver to join our Camden branch to deliver exceptional service to trade and retail customers.

Role Overview

As an HGV Class 2 Hiab driver based at our Camden branch, you will safely operate a Class 2 vehicle fitted with a Hiab crane to deliver and offload building materials to sites and customers across London and the surrounding area. The role requires a professional, customer‑focused approach, good knowledge of site delivery procedures, and the ability to work flexibly in a fast‑moving environment.

Working hours

This is a full‑time, permanent role. Typical hours range between Monday to Friday 06.30 – 17:00 with 1 in 2 Saturdays working 08.00 - 12.00 = 44.5 hours per week. Flexibility required to meet customer needs. Hours may vary depending on operational requirements.

Main responsibilities

  • Safely operate Class 2 HGVs fitted with a Hiab crane, carrying out pre‑start checks and routine vehicle inspections.
  • Deliver, position and offload building materials to customer sites using the Hiab crane, ensuring safe and correct placement of goods.
  • Ensure all loads are secured and compliant with relevant road and company regulations.
  • Complete delivery paperwork accurately, including electronic proof of delivery and any site-specific documentation.
  • Provide excellent customer service at all times, representing Lawsons professionally on site.
  • Liaise with yard and branch colleagues to coordinate collections, routes and schedules.
  • Report any vehicle defects, delivery issues or customer concerns to management promptly.
  • Adhere to all health & safety policies and safe working practices, including site-specific rules and risk assessments.
  • Maintain the cleanliness and basic upkeep of the vehicle and Hiab equipment.

Skills & experience

  • Valid UK Category C (Class 2) driving licence with current digital driver qualification card (DQC) and CPC (Driver Certificate of Professional Competence).
  • Proven experience operating a Hiab/crane on deliveries in an urban environment (essential).
  • Good knowledge of safe loading, sling use and offloading techniques.
  • Excellent customer service skills with a professional and courteous manner on site.
  • Reliable, punctual and able to work independently with good timekeeping and organisational skills.
  • Awareness of road traffic regulations, LOLER and general vehicle maintenance checks.
  • Ability to work flexibly and adapt to changing schedules and customer requirements.
  • Previous experience within builders’ merchants, timber or landscaping logistics is desirable.
